Denver sets record high temperature for March 25

Record High Temperature

Our summer-like conditions continued today and another high temperature record fell. More than that, it also set an all-time March high temperature record.

As measured at Denver International Airport, Denver saw an official high temperature of 87 degrees. This easily breaks the old record high for March 25 of 75 degrees set in 1956.

The reading today also breaks the all-time record high for March, besting the 86 degrees we saw just four days ago. Prior to this most recent heat wave, the record for March was 84 degrees set on March 26, 1971.

Here in Thornton, we were warmer than the Mile High City with a high of 90 degrees.
